Work Package 3
Educational Resources
for Sustainable Farming
It constitutes the pedagogical core of the FarmForward project.
Dual Purpose: FarmForward will co-develop a rich package of “Educational Resources for Sustainable Farming”—a series of nine thematic booklets, interactive e-modules and a decision-support toolkit—designed to give farmers the practical know-how to adopt climate-smart methods on their own holdings. At the same time, those materials will be rigorously tested through hands-on workshops and on-farm demonstrations in each partner country to refine content, methodology and usability under real-world conditions
Main Results
The Main Results of WP3 will feature a suite of nine thematic booklets meticulously designed to guide farmers through every facet of climate-smart agriculture:
- The “Climate Shifts in Agriculture” booklet explores evolving weather patterns and their direct effects on productivity, underscoring the urgency of adaptive measures.
- The “Precision Agriculture Principles” booklet delves into technology-driven farm management techniques that boost efficiency and sustainability.
- The “Climate-Smart Technologies” booklet showcases cutting-edge tools and their practical on-farm applications for resilience.
- The “Nature-based Solutions for Farming” booklet outlines how to harness ecological processes to maintain soil health and biodiversity.
- The “Renewable Energy in Farming” booklet examines integrating solar, wind and bioenergy to reduce carbon footprints and enhance energy security.
- The “Integrated Pest Management Strategies” booklet presents eco-friendly approaches that balance crop protection with environmental well-being.
- The “Regeneration Techniques in Farming” booklet focuses on restorative practices that rebuild natural resources and foster ecosystem services.
- The “Community-Driven Climate Action in Agriculture” booklet encourages collective, local initiatives for shared resilience.
- The “Future Farming: Advanced Agricultural Technologies” booklet looks ahead to AI, automation and other innovations set to redefine sustainable food production.
Each booklet will be enriched by real-world case studies from on-farm demonstrations, iteratively refined through pilot feedback, and translated into all five partner languages to ensure accessibility and relevance across diverse agro-ecological contexts .
